    After a successful theatrical run, acclaimed filmmaker Mari Selvaraj’s latest emotional drama Vaazhai is all set to make its digital debut. Starring Ponvel M, Raghul R, Kalaiyarasan, and Nikhila Vimal, the film is a semi-autobiographical drama based on a poignant incident from Mari Selvaraj’s life. The film marks Mari Selvaraj’s fourth directorial venture.

    Vaazhai to stream on Disney+ Hotstar

    The OTT platform, Disney+ Hotstar, took to its official handle to announce that the Mari Selvaraj directorial will be available for streaming on the platform starting October 11, 2024. Sharing the movie poster, the platform wrote, “ஒரு உன்னதமான படைப்பு #vaazhai #Vaazhai Streaming From October 11 on Disney+ Hotstar. Streaming in Hindi, Telugu, Malayalam, Kannada, Bengali, and Marathi.”

    What is Vaazhai all about?

    Written, directed, and produced by Mari Selvaraj himself, the film follows the tragic life story of Sivanandhan, a twelve-year-old boy who works as a plantain labourer. Upon its release, the film received overwhelming responses from audiences, who praised the filmmaker for delivering a heart-wrenching drama that conveys an important message. The film went on to not just become a critically acclaimed film, but also a box office hit, minting more than ₹40 crore against its ₹5 crore budget. The film stars Ponvel M, Raghul R, Kalaiyarasan, Nikhila Vimal, J Sathish Kumar, Dhivya Duraisamy, and Janaki in key roles. This film also marks Mari Selvaraj’s debut as a producer. On the technical front, Santhosh Narayanan composed the original score and soundtrack for the film, while Theni Eswar served as the cinematographer, and Suriya Pradhaman handled the editing.

    Vaazhai sequel in the making

    Recently, filmmaker Mari Selvaraj announced that he will soon be making a sequel to the emotional drama, which will delve even deeper into the story behind the first installment. He also promises the audience that the sequel will be even more hard-hitting compared to the first part.

    Mari Selvaraj is currently filming his upcoming directorial project with Dhruv Vikram, titled Bison.
